Agri-business and Entrepreneurship Development for Enhanced Food Security Course

INTRODUCTION

Private sector development is relatively weak despite Governments’ effort to encourage it. The vast majority of populations are active in subsistence agricultural production. Weak private sector development combined with a saturated employment market in other segments (such as government) results in decreasing opportunities. The investment in developing a more entrepreneurial attitude with a focus on agri-business development is lacking. With a more entrepreneurial attitude and skills, unemployment rates could drop. This course is meant for stakeholders who want to improve the entrepreneurial skills of their people who are willing to set up their own business and at the same time help develop the rural environment and economy in a sustainable way through agribusiness.

LEARNING OBJECTIVES

Participants will be able to:

  • Identify ideal agribusiness ventures and how to get financing for the ventures.
  • Identify and enhance the necessary competencies for entrepreneurship development;
  • Evaluate and adopt the best methodologies that could be introduced to stimulate entrepreneurial competencies;
  • Design modules addressing different aspects of entrepreneurship that can be put to practice;

Topics to be covered

  • Farmer financing to modernize value chains
  • Promoting access to finance for farmers and SMEs
  • Increasing access to finance for farmers and SMEs
  • Investing in the private sector to feed the most vulnerable
  • Supporting local smallholder farmers to engage in agribusiness.
  • Helping farmer cooperatives gain access to finance and training
  • Raising Incomes for Farmers by connecting them to Markets
  • Strengthening Critical Segments along the agribusiness value chains.
  • Increasing Microfinancing to Rural and Agribusiness Sectors.
  • Supporting Farmers through Warehouse Financing
  • Challenges faced by new Entrepreneurs
  • How to overcome hurdles and pitfalls faced by new business starters
  • Concept of an enabling business environment
  • Entrepreneurial life cycle
  • Entrepreneurship and the economy
  • Entrepreneurship in agriculture (“Agropreneurship”)
  • The role of farmers' entrepreneurial skills
  • The importance of technology and innovation in agriculture
  • Agriculture and youth: the importance of making agriculture more attractive
